NJ, feds sue commission to protect drinking water from contamination

The Passaic Valley Water Commission has failed to cover three reservoirs to protect treated drinking water from contamination, a new lawsuit says.

The state and the feds have teamed up to compel a North Jersey water system to cover three reservoirs that provide drinking water to nearly a million people.
